Combo Kits
Combo kits are a great way to save money on power tools, whether you're starting from scratch or expanding your existing collection. They typically consist of two or more common cordless tools, batteries and charger. Some sets include bags or cases for easy transport and storage. Consider the number of included tools when choosing the right kit, and pay particular attention to features such as the size of the chuck, whether the drill or driver is brush-style or brushless, and the amp-hours and voltage of the batteries. Tools with greater amp-hours and higher voltage give more power, while tools with smaller chucks can use standard bits for lighter tasks and faster project completion.
There are combo power tool kits for various DIY projects. They can be for small tasks such as replacing cabinet hardware or larger projects like framing a shed, or constructing new deck steps. There are kits that come with corded or cordless options. Certain combo sets are designed to work with the same battery platform. This makes it easy to expand your tool collection and take on more projects.

Cordless Tools
Corded and cordless tools are readily available for power tool buyers. Both have advantages and disadvantages depending on the work environment, and project requirements. The corded power tools are ideal for heavy-duty jobs that require constant power. Power tools that are cordless offer more mobility and flexibility without the limitations of a cord.
Selecting the right power tool is vital to the success of your project. If you take the time to read reviews and research brands and models and test power tools, you'll get superior performance as well as durability and overall value. It's also important to think about future requirements, so look for a platform that has expansion options.
The advancement of lithium-ion technology in power tools that are cordless has enabled manufacturers to create high-performance tools that are light and compact and have impressive time to run and recharge. They are also more portable and easily maneuverable, making them ideal for outdoor work or remote working environments.
When selecting a cordless tool take into consideration the number of tools included in the kit, as well as the battery capacity. If you purchase tools a kit that includes multiple batteries will allow you to swap out drained batteries, giving you the capability to work in a continuous manner. Also, pay attention to the amp-hours and voltages of each battery. Batteries with higher voltage will offer more power, and higher amp-hours will extend time to run.
Making the investment in high-quality power tools will improve efficiency, durability and performance. Find a brand that has a wide selection of corded and cordless tools, as well as accessories that work with both types of. In addition to having a broad choice, a brand of power tools should also offer competitive pricing and extended warranty coverage. Apart from the initial cost, it's also important to take into account ongoing costs, including maintenance, replacement batteries, and energy consumption. These expenses can quickly add up therefore it's essential to factor these expenses into your budget when you're comparing corded and cordless power tools.

Maintenance is crucial for any tool. Lubrication is crucial to prevent internal motor parts from overheating or getting corroded. It is essential to keep an ongoing schedule of calibration. Certain devices require a calibration after a certain period of time. Other tools require a set number of events.
It's also important to keep a regular schedule for charging. If a battery doesn't get regularly charged, it could lose capacity and become unusable. The owner's manual will give you a suggested charging schedule. It is also essential to keep tools and batteries in a climate-controlled environment. This will extend their lifespan.
